Yesterday, Senator’s Orrin Hatch (R-UT) and Ron Wyden (D-OR) and Rep. Paul Ryan (R-WI) introduced Fast-Track legislation, an anti-democratic procedure that gives away Congress’ Constitutional trade authority to the President.
All the while, the vast majority of Americans (75%) think that current “free trade agreements” should be delayed or rejected, according to a bipartisan poll from the Wall Street Journal and NBC News.

The Trans-Pacific Partnership (TPP) is the biggest and most sweeping international trade agreement in our nation’s history and Fast-Track trade authority would give the President the ability to force a quick up or down vote while bypassing our democratic process.
AND, this so-called “free” trade deal has been negotiated entirely in secret by corporate lobbyists.
- This trade agreement would increase the import of food from foreign sources without the checks of U.S. food safety standards.
- These trade agreements could take away local control, nullify Missouri laws and undermine the U.S. Constitution.
- The TPP could also strip laws that protect our “right to know” where our food comes from, such as Country of Origin Labeling (COOL).
